Output 8d7461389dbf1c2dceef841bb68c7922c78268befc7d648b4e15fa29d8a2c9e2:0

value
657093
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 578bf54c0df7d0ba4a45c19a11e0876ea4bbb012 OP_EQUALVERIFY OP_CHECKSIG
address
18yuT9z42eK9GX9v4kmuZcF3ed4jQctJbx
transaction
8d7461389dbf1c2dceef841bb68c7922c78268befc7d648b4e15fa29d8a2c9e2
confirmations
149845
spent
true